Chapter 10.10.09. Law Enforcement Laboratories—Personnel Certification and Approval of Laboratory Procedures |
Sec. 10.10.09.01. Qualifications
-
A. Certified Chemist and Certified Chemical Analyst. An applicant for certified chemist or certified chemical analyst shall:
(1) Hold a b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university with a major in chemistry, medical technology, biology, physics, pharmacy, pharmacology, or forensic science;
(2) Have completed courses in analytical and organic chemistry; and
(3) Have completed a basic training program for certified chemist or certified chemical analyst as set forth in Regulation .02 of this chapter.
B. Certified Analyst. An applicant for certified analyst shall:
(1) Possess a high school diploma or its equivalent;
(2) Have completed a basic training program for certified analyst as set forth in Regulation .02 of this chapter; and
(3) Identify in the application those specific drug-testing procedures for which certification is being sought and for which training has been received.
